About SAB

SAB has been a cornerstone of South Africa’s economy for over a century. With 7 breweries, 42 depots, a workforce of approximately 5 000 employees, and a beer economy supporting over 250 000 jobs across the value chain, the company operates at significant scale. Its brand portfolio includes Castle Lager, Carling Black Label, Corona, Brutal Fruit, and Flying Fish — names that are woven into the fabric of South African life.

About the Programme

The Engineering Trainee Programme is an 18-month structured initiative built to equip graduates with the technical skills, operational experience, and cultural grounding needed to perform effectively in a complex brewery environment. The programme is primarily hands-on and self-directed, supported by structured learning and active participation in brewery operations.

Trainees rotate across departments, gaining a thorough understanding of equipment theory, principles, and operation. Where possible, trainees participate in leadership roles within team structures, preparing them to step into responsibilities immediately upon completion.
